Define the organization’s core purpose
Identify the primary customers or beneficiaries
State what you deliver (products, services, outcomes)
Clarify the key values and principles that guide decisions
Specify the scope of your mission (what you do and what you do not do)
Describe the impact you aim to create
Use clear, concise, non-technical language
Keep it specific enough to guide priorities
Ensure it is distinct from your vision and goals
Align it with your strategy and measurable direction
Draft a short statement (typically one to three sentences)
Use active voice and present tense
Avoid jargon, buzzwords, and vague terms like “world-class” without specifics
Validate wording with leadership and stakeholders
Test for clarity: “Can someone repeat it accurately after reading once?”
Revise based on feedback and consistency with organizational values
Finalize and publish the mission statement
Review periodically and update when strategy or context changes
